Numbers 3

1 Now these are the generations of Aaron and Moses in the day that Jehovah spake with Moses in mount Sinai.2 And these are the names of the sons of Aaron: Nadab the first-born, and Abihu, Eleazar, and Ithamar.3 These are the names of the sons of Aaron, the priests that were anointed, whom he consecrated to minister in the priest’s office.4 And Nadab and Abihu died before Jehovah, when they offered strange fire before Jehovah, in the wilderness of Sinai, and they had no children; and Eleazar and Ithamar ministered in the priest’s office in the presence of Aaron their father.

5 And Jehovah spake unto Moses, saying,6 Bring the tribe of Levi near, and set them before Aaron the priest, that they may minister unto him.7 And they shall keep his charge, and the charge of the whole congregation before the tent of meeting, to do the service of the tabernacle.8 And they shall keep all the furniture of the tent of meeting, and the charge of the children of Israel, to do the service of the tabernacle.9 And thou shalt give the Levites unto Aaron and to his sons: they are wholly given unto him on the behalf of the children of Israel.10 And thou shalt appoint Aaron and his sons, and they shall keep their priesthood: and the stranger that cometh nigh shall be put to death.

11 And Jehovah spake unto Moses, saying,12 And I, behold, I have taken the Levites from among the children of Israel instead of all the first-born that openeth the womb among the children of Israel; and the Levites shall be mine:13 for all the first-born are mine; on the day that I smote all the first-born in the land of Egypt I hallowed unto me all the first-born in Israel, both man and beast; mine they shall be: I am Jehovah.

14 And Jehovah spake unto Moses in the wilderness of Sinai, saying,15 Number the children of Levi by their fathers’ houses, by their families: every male from a month old and upward shalt thou number them.16 And Moses numbered them according to the word of Jehovah, as he was commanded.17 And these were the sons of Levi by their names: Gershon, and Kohath, and Merari.18 And these are the names of the sons of Gershon by their families: Libni and Shimei.19 And the sons of Kohath by their families: Amram, and Izhar, Hebron, and Uzziel.20 And the sons of Merari by their families: Mahli and Mushi. These are the families of the Levites according to their fathers’ houses.

21 Of Gershon was the family of the Libnites, and the family of the Shimeites: these are the families of the Gershonites.22 Those that were numbered of them, according to the number of all the males, from a month old and upward, even those that were numbered of them were seven thousand and five hundred.23 The families of the Gershonites shall encamp behind the tabernacle westward.24 And the prince of the fathers’ house of the Gershonites shall be Eliasaph the son of Lael.25 And the charge of the sons of Gershon in the tent of meeting shall be the tabernacle, and the Tent, the covering thereof, and the screen for the door of the tent of meeting,26 and the hangings of the court, and the screen for the door of the court, which is by the tabernacle, and by the altar round about, and the cords of it for all the service thereof.

27 And of Kohath was the family of the Amramites, and the family of the Izharites, and the family of the Hebronites, and the family of the Uzzielites: these are the families of the Kohathites.28 According to the number of all the males, from a month old and upward, there were eight thousand and six hundred, keeping the charge of the sanctuary.29 The families of the sons of Kohath shall encamp on the side of the tabernacle southward.30 And the prince of the fathers’ house of the families of the Kohathites shall be Elizaphan the son of Uzziel.31 And their charge shall be the ark, and the table, and the candlestick, and the altars, and the vessels of the sanctuary wherewith they minister, and the screen, and all the service thereof.32 And Eleazar the son of Aaron the priest shall be prince of the princes of the Levites, and have the oversight of them that keep the charge of the sanctuary.

33 Of Merari was the family of the Mahlites, and the family of the Mushites: these are the families of Merari.34 And those that were numbered of them, according to the number of all the males, from a month old and upward, were six thousand and two hundred.35 And the prince of the fathers’ house of the families of Merari was Zuriel the son of Abihail: they shall encamp on the side of the tabernacle northward.36 And the appointed charge of the sons of Merari shall be the boards of the tabernacle, and the bars thereof, and the pillars thereof, and the sockets thereof, and all the instruments thereof, and all the service thereof,37 and the pillars of the court round about, and their sockets, and their pins, and their cords.

38 And those that encamp before the tabernacle eastward, before the tent of meeting toward the sunrising, shall be Moses, and Aaron and his sons, keeping the charge of the sanctuary for the charge of the children of Israel; and the stranger that cometh nigh shall be put to death.39 All that were numbered of the Levites, whom Moses and Aaron numbered at the commandment of Jehovah, by their families, all the males from a month old and upward, were twenty and two thousand.

40 And Jehovah said unto Moses, Number all the first-born males of the children of Israel from a month old and upward, and take the number of their names.41 And thou shalt take the Levites for me (I am Jehovah) instead of all the first-born among the children of Israel; and the cattle of the Levites instead of all the firstlings among the cattle of the children of Israel:42 and Moses numbered, as Jehovah commanded him, all the first-born among the children of Israel.43 And all the first-born males according to the number of names, from a month old and upward, of those that were numbered of them, were twenty and two thousand two hundred and threescore and thirteen.

44 And Jehovah spake unto Moses, saying,45 Take the Levites instead of all the first-born among the children of Israel, and the cattle of the Levites instead of their cattle; and the Levites shall be mine: I am Jehovah.46 And for the redemption of the two hundred and threescore and thirteen of the first-born of the children of Israel, that are over and above the number of the Levites,47 thou shalt take five shekels apiece by the poll; after the shekel of the sanctuary shalt thou take them (the shekel is twenty gerahs):48 and thou shalt give the money, wherewith the odd number of them is redeemed, unto Aaron and to his sons.49 And Moses took the redemption-money from them that were over and above them that were redeemed by the Levites;50 from the first-born of the children of Israel took he the money, a thousand three hundred and threescore and five shekels, after the shekel of the sanctuary:51 and Moses gave the redemption-money unto Aaron and to his sons, according to the word of Jehovah, as Jehovah commanded Moses.

Numbers 3

The sons of Aaron

1 When the Lord talked with Moses on Mount Sinai, 2 Aaron's four sons, Nadab, Abihu, Eleazar, and Ithamar,t 3 were the ones to be ordained as priests.

4 But the Lord killed Nadab and Abihu in the Sinai Desert when they used fire that was unacceptablet in their offering to the Lord.t And because Nadab and Abihu had no sons, only Eleazar and Ithamar served as priests with their father Aaron.t

The duties of the Levites


5 The Lord said to Moses:
6 Assign the Levi tribe to Aaron the priest. They will be his assistants 7 and will work at the sacred tent for him and for all the Israelites. 8 The Levites will serve the community by being responsible for the furnishings of the tent. 9 They are assigned to help Aaron and his sons,

10 who have been appointed to be priests. Anyone else who tries to perform the duties of a priest must be put to death.

11-13 Moses, I have chosen these Levites from all Israel, and they will belong to me in a special way. When I killed the firstborn sons of the Egyptians, I decided that the firstborn sons in every Israelite family and the firstborn males of their flocks and herds would be mine.t But now I accept these Levites in place of the firstborn sons of the Israelites.t

The Levites are counted


14 In the Sinai Desert the Lord said to Moses, 15 “Now I want you to count the men and boys in the Levi tribe by families and by clans. Include every one at least a month old.”

16 So Moses obeyed and counted them.
17 Levi's three sons, Gershon, Kohath, and Merari, had become the heads of their own clans. 18 Gershon's sons were Libni and Shimei. 19 Kohath's sons were Amram, Izhar, Hebron, and Uzziel.

20 And Merari's sons were Mahli and Mushi. These were the sons and grandsons of Levi, and they had become the leaders of the Levite clans.
21 The two Gershon clans were the Libnites and Shimeites, 22 and they had seven thousand five hundred men and boys at least one month old. 23 The Gershonites were to camp on the west side of the sacred tent, 24 under the leadership of Eliasaph son of Lael. 25 Their duties at the tent included taking care of the tent itself, along with its outer covering, the curtain for the entrance,

26 the curtains hanging inside the courtyard around the tent, as well as the curtain and ropes for the entrance to the courtyard and its altar. The Gershonites were responsible for setting these things up and taking them down.
27 The four Kohath clans were the Amramites, Izharites, Hebronites, and the Uzzielites, 28 and they had eight thousand six hundredt men and boys at least one month old. 29 The Kohathites were to camp on the south side of the sacred tent, 30 under the leadership of Elizaphan son of Uzziel.

31 Their duties at the tent included taking care of the sacred chest, the table for the sacred bread, the lampstand, the altars, the objects used for worship, and the curtain in front of the most holy place. The Kohathites were responsible for setting these things up and taking them down.

32 Eleazar son of Aaron was the head of the Levite leaders, and he made sure that the work at the sacred tent was done.
33 The two Merari clans were the Mahlites and the Mushites, 34 and they had six thousand two hundred men and boys at least one month old. 35 The Merarites were to camp on the north side of the sacred tent, under the leadership of Zuriel son of Abihail.

36-37 Their duties included taking care of the tent frames and the pieces that held the tent up: the bars, the posts, the stands, and its other equipment. They were also in charge of the posts that supported the courtyard, as well as their stands, tent pegs, and ropes. The Merari clans were responsible for setting these things up and taking them down.

38 Moses, Aaron, and his sons were to camp in front of the sacred tent, on the east side, and to make sure that the Israelites worshipped in the proper way. Anyone else who tried to do the work of Moses and Aaron was to be put to death.

39 So Moses and Aaron obeyed the Lord and counted the Levites by their clans. The total number of Levites at least one month old was twenty-two thousand.

The Levites are accepted as substitutes for the firstborn sons


40 The Lord said to Moses, “Make a list and count the firstborn sons at least one month old in each of the Israelite families.

41 They belong to me, but I will accept the Levites as substitutes for them, and I will accept the Levites' livestock as substitutes for the Israelites' firstborn livestock.”
42 Moses obeyed the Lord and counted the firstborn sons;

43 there were 22,273 of them.
44 Then the Lord said, 45 “The Levites will belong to me and will take the place of the firstborn sons; their livestock will take the place of the Israelites' firstborn livestock. 46 But since there are more firstborn sons than Levites, the extra two hundred and seventy-three men and boys must be bought back from me. 47 For each one, you are to collect five pieces of silver, weighed according to the official standards.

48 This money must then be given to Aaron and his sons.”
49 Moses collected the silver from the extra two hundred and seventy-three firstborn men and boys, 50 and it amounted to one thousand three hundred and sixty-five pieces of silver, weighed according to the official standards. 51 Then he gave it to Aaron and his sons, just as the Lord had commanded.
